Each year, the budget must receive a positive certification by the Ventura County Office of Education. The state requires Ventura Unified School District (VUSD) to account for the next three years when negotiating. When we negotiate this year, we must do so planning through the 2027-28 school year. 

VUSD has been significantly impacted by several years of declining enrollment, lower-than-normal attendance, and loss of one-time funding. This has led the District to need to make budget reductions. We remain committed to transparency and will keep you informed as we navigate this process together.
